The South Korea preterm birth and PROM (premature rupture of membranes) testing market is experiencing growth driven by factors such as increasing awareness about the importance of early detection and management of preterm birth risks, rising healthcare expenditure, and advancements in diagnostic technologies. Key players in the market are focusing on developing innovative testing solutions to cater to the growing demand for accurate and reliable diagnostic tools. Hospitals and clinics are the major end-users of these testing services, with a rising number of pregnant women opting for prenatal screening and testing. Government initiatives aimed at reducing preterm birth rates and improving maternal and infant health outcomes are also contributing to the market growth. Overall, the South Korea preterm birth and PROM testing market is poised for further expansion in the coming years.

In the South Korea Preterm Birth and PROM (premature rupture of membranes) testing market, some key challenges include limited awareness among the general public about the importance of early detection and intervention for preterm birth, as well as the high cost associated with advanced diagnostic tests. Additionally, there may be regulatory hurdles and cultural factors that influence the adoption of new testing technologies. Healthcare providers may also face challenges in accessing specialized training and resources for accurate testing and interpretation of results. Moreover, the competitive landscape in the market, with multiple companies offering different testing solutions, can lead to confusion among healthcare professionals and patients regarding the most effective and reliable testing options available. Addressing these challenges will be crucial for improving preterm birth and PROM testing outcomes in South Korea.

In South Korea, government policies related to the Preterm Birth and PROM (Premature Rupture of Membranes) Testing Market focus on improving maternal and infant health outcomes. The Ministry of Health and Welfare has implemented various initiatives to enhance prenatal care services, including promoting routine screening for preterm birth risk factors and offering early detection and management of PROM. Additionally, the government emphasizes the importance of research and development in the field of maternal-fetal medicine to advance diagnostic technologies for better prediction and prevention of preterm birth and PROM. These policies aim to reduce the incidence of preterm birth and its associated complications, ultimately improving the overall health and well-being of mothers and newborns in South Korea.
